人工智能软件定制如何管理好过程

我有开发需求

  • 联系电话:

    *
  • 9+4等于

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。

人工智能软件定制是一种根据特定用户需求定制的软件开发方法。随着人工智能技术的不断发展,越来越多的企业和个人开始考虑使用人工智能软件定制来满足自己的需求。然而,这种定制化的软件开发方法需要严格的过程管理,以确保项目的成功。
本文将探讨人工智能软件定制的过程管理,包括以下方面:
1. 确定项目目标和需求
在开始人工智能软件定制之前,首先需要确定项目目标和需求。这一步骤非常重要,因为如果未能清晰地定义需求,项目可能会出现偏差,导致最终的产品与预期不符。
为了确保项目目标和需求的明确性,开发团队应该与客户密切合作,了解他们的需求和期望。这可以通过与客户进行面谈、问卷调查、用户研究和原型设计等方式实现。在收集需求时,开发团队应该注意以下几点:
- 确定需求的优先级:根据客户的需求,确定哪些功能是最重要的,哪些功能可以在以后添加。
- 确定需求的约束条件:根据客户的需求,确定哪些功能是不可能实现的,哪些功能需要特定的技术和资源。
- 确定需求的实现方式:根据客户的需求,确定哪些功能可以通过人工智能技术实现,哪些功能需要其他技术或手动实现。
2. 制定项目计划和时间表
在确定了项目目标和需求后,开发团队需要制定项目计划和时间表。项目计划应该包括项目的范围、目标、任务、资源、预算和时间表。时间表应该明确列出每个任务的开始和结束日期,以及项目的重要里程碑。
制定项目计划和时间表可以帮助开发团队更好地管理项目,确保项目按时完成并符合预期。此外,项目计划和时间表还可以帮助开发团队更好地与客户沟通,让客户了解项目的进展情况。
3. 开发和测试
在项目计划和时间表确定后,开发团队可以开始开发软件。在开发过程中,开发团队应该遵循最佳的实践和准则,确保代码的质量和可维护性。
在开发完成后,开发团队应该进行测试,确保软件能够满足客户的需求和期望。测试应该包括功能测试、性能测试、安全测试和兼容性测试等,以确保软件的稳定性和可靠性。
4. 部署和维护
在软件测试通过后,开发团队可以开始部署软件。部署过程中,应该注意监控软件的性能和稳定性,并及时处理可能出现的问题。
部署完成后,开发团队应该对软件进行维护,确保其正常运行。维护过程应该包括对软件的更新和升级,以及对客户反馈的问题进行修复。
5. 项目评估和反思
最后,开发团队应该对项目进行评估和反思,确定项目的成功度,并总结项目的经验教训。项目评估应该包括对项目的成本、进度和质量的评估,以及对客户的满意度调查。
从上述五个方面可以看出,人工智能软件定制的成功实施需要严格的过程管理。只有通过明确项目目标和需求、制定项目计划和时间表、仔细开发和测试、及时部署和维护以及最后的项目评估和反思,才能确保项目的成功。

有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。